Caution Quote by Samuel Johnson
“Those who are in the power of evil habits must conquer them as they can; and conquered they must be, or neither wisdom nor happiness can be attained: but those who are not yet subject to their influence may, by timely caution, preserve their freedom;”
About This Quote
Source Essay: The Rambler, 1750
Evil habits dominate unless actively resisted; without overcoming them, wisdom and happiness remain out of reach.
In simple terms: Bad habits block wisdom and joy.
Conquer harmful habits to gain freedom.
